Description
Trasturel 440mg Injection contains Trustuzumab as an active ingredient which is a humanized monoclonal antibody. This medicine is prescribed to treat advanced and metastatic breast cancer and metastatic gastric cancer.
It works by inhibiting the action of HER2 receptor to control the multiplication and survival of cancer cells. This injection should be administered into the vein by a doctor or experienced nurse. Don't self- administer the injection.
Uses
- Advanced and metastatic breast cancer
- Metastatic gastric cancer
Side Effects
Trasturel 440mg Injection is a strong anticancer medicine that may show certain adverse while manageable impact on the body during the treatment. As these effects resolve on their own without any special medical attention. However, if you ever experience serious or unusual side effects contact your healthcare professional immediately.
Some common side effects include:
- Headache
- Fatigue
- Neutropenia (Low white blood cells)
- Nausea and Vomiting
- Rash
- Diarrhea
- Infections
- Fever
- Infusion reactions (e.g., chills, fever, pain)
- Anaemia (Low red blood cells)
Serious Side Effects of Injection are:
- Congestive heart failure (CHF)
- Pulmonary toxicity (Lung issues)
- Cardiomyopathy (Heart dysfunction)
- Severe infusion reactions (e.g., difficulty breathing, low blood pressure)

How It Works
- Trasturel 440mg Injection contains Trustuzumab as an active ingredient which is a humanized monoclonal antibody. It works by blocking the action of HER2 receptor that promote growth and survival of cancer cells in breast and gastric cancer.
- Thereby, by selectively binds to HER2 it controls or inhibit the growth & multiplication of cancer cells to slow down the progression of disease.
